Neighborhood

As its name implies, the Museum District is home to 19 museums. This historic neighborhood is home to the Houston Museum of Natural Science, the Children's Museum of Houston, the Contemporary Art Museum, and other cultural centers. Each year over 8 million visitors explore this cultural hub! Residents also have access to one of Houston’s favorite parks, Hermann Park, massive green space housing the Houston Zoo, an Amphitheatre, gardens, and more. Great for students, faculty, and staff, the district is also convenient to several universities including Texas Southern University and Rice University. After you’re done exploring museums, the Museum District also has several coffee shops, cafes, restaurants, and nightlife spots. For even more shopping, dining, and entertainment options, Midtown and Downtown Houston aren’t far from the neighborhood. This bustling cultural mecca has surprisingly affordable apartments along with more upscale rentals available as well.

What do Walkability, Transit, Drivability, and Bikeability mean? Walkability measures the walking distance to day-to-day needs. Transit measures access to public transportation. Drivability measures congestion, parking availability, and access to major roads. Bikeability measures the suitability for cycling. How It Works
